There are three organs that are the most responsible for providing the body with enzymes. They are the stomach and small intestine and the pancreas.

Among these, the pancreas is considered to be the “powerhouse” in the human body as it provides the enzymes required to are responsible for breaking down proteins, carbohydrates and fats.

You might already know this however, there are many types of digestive enzymes which break down different kinds of food. The pancreas alone, the engine that we discussed earlier, produces three types of digestive enzymes that are the main ones. These are:

  • Amylase, which helps break down complex carbohydrates. Amylase breaks down complex. Also , it is produced in the mouth.
  • Lipase, which breaks down fats.
  • Protease breaks down proteins.

The small intestine also produces certain major enzymes that include:

  • Lactase which breaks down lactose.
  • Sucrase which breaks down sucrose.

If your body is lacking certain enzymes, or if their bodies do not have the capacity to release required enzymes, they could be suffering from a condition known as digestive enzyme insufficiency.

When someone has digestive enzyme insufficiency, they lack the ability to break down certain foods and absorb certain nutrients. Lactose intolerance is a situation where the body is unable to produce enough lactase to digest the sugars in dairy and milk products.

Digestive Enzyme Insufficiency (DEI) isn’t a condition to be taken lightly. It can cause malnutrition and gastrointestinal irritation. Symptoms of these can include:

  • Belly pain or cramps
  • Bloating
  • Diarrhea
  • Gas
  • Stools that are oily
  • Unexplained weight loss.

  • Cellulase, Hemicellulase, xylanase, pectinase The enzymes in this group are responsible for breaking down the plant matter that are consumed in your daily diet. Particularly, they work on digestion of the difficult to digest cell walls of plant cells and the plant fibers that are present in these types of diet.
  • Phytase is among the vital enzymes required for digestion. The phytase enzyme is an essential enzyme when we talk about bone health. When phytase is activated it is able to break down a chemical called phytic acid. Phytic acid can bind to important minerals needed by the body like zinc and iron. With Phytase it is possible for these zinc and iron are released and easily absorbed by the body.
